Output 8500076fce1d899108b41872b697a30afe0644cb0bacbb1977e82b42e3e62365:1

value
6513195
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37a7100808ba17ab3e232ecd749e99f0de8456d1 OP_EQUALVERIFY OP_CHECKSIG
address
165GJGP6H6KWaKV3Vo6BAC5sxv6XAvDVUC
transaction
8500076fce1d899108b41872b697a30afe0644cb0bacbb1977e82b42e3e62365
confirmations
325134
spent
true